[GROLIER CLUB]. LE ROUX DE LINCY, Adrien Jean Victor. Researches concerning Jean Grolier. New York, 1907. 4 o, plates. Half-morocco gilt (rubbed). LIMITED EDITION of 300 copies. -- DE VINNE, Theodore. Title-Pages as seen by a Printer. New York, 1901. 8 o, plates. Original half-morocco gilt with Grolier Club stamp on boards (lightly rubbed). Slipcase (rubbed). LIMITED EDITION of 325 copies printed at The De Vinne Press. -- MATTHEWS, William. Modern Bookbinding Practically Considered. New York, 1889. 4 o, plates. Original cloth stamped in gilt (chipped at top of spine). LIMITED EDITION of 300 copies printed at The De Vinne Press. -- WROTH, Lawrence C. The Colonial Printer. New York, 1931. 8 o, plates. Original cloth (rubbed). LIMITED EDITION of 300 copies printed at The Merrymount Press. -- The Engraved and Typographical Work of Rudolph Ruzicka. New York, 1948. 8 o, illustrated. Original wrappers (lightly rubbed). LIMITED EDITION SIGNED one of 500 copies. -- Transactions of the Grolier Club. New York, 1885-1921. 4 vols. 8 o. Vols. 1-3 in half-morocco gilt and marbled boards (rubbed) and vol. 4 in original boards and dust jacket (chips, faded). -- The Grolier Club. New York, 1920-1950. 24 vols. 12 o. 12 in boards, 12 in wrappers. Annual reports to officers and committee members. -- And 5 others, v.d., various sizes and bindings (conditions vary). (38)
